Introduction | During the 1960s in Berkeley, I became immersed in the many movements associated with that period while getting a Field Major in Social Sciences and studying theology for two years at the Pacific School of Religion. In 1968, I dedicated my life to helping to organize supportive, activist communities. I drive taxi part-time. For a brief bio, see http://progressiveresourcecatalog.org/index.php/About/WadeHudson |
